Ping հրաման

Ping հրամանների օրինակներ, ընտրանքներ, անջատիչներ եւ այլն

The ping հրամանը հրամանատարության արագության հրաման է, որը փորձարկվում է աղբյուրի համակարգչի ունակությունը ստուգելու համար սահմանված նպատակակետ համակարգչին: The ping հրամանը սովորաբար օգտագործվում է որպես պարզ միջոց հաստատելու համար, որ համակարգիչը կարող է հաղորդակցվել ցանցի վրա մեկ այլ համակարգչի կամ ցանցային սարքով:

The ping հրամանատարությունը գործում է, ուղարկելով Internet Control Message Protocol (ICMP) Echo Request- ի հաղորդագրությունները նպատակակետին համակարգչին եւ սպասում է պատասխանին:

Այդ արձագանքներից քանիսը վերադարձվում են, եւ որքան ժամանակ է պահանջվում նրանց վերադարձնել, երկու հիմնական տեղեկությունները, որոնք տալիս են պինգի հրամանը:

Օրինակ, դուք կարող եք գտնել, որ ցանցային տպիչով գրառումներ չկան, միայն պարզել, որ տպիչը անցանց է եւ փոխարինվում է դրա կաբելը: Կամ գուցե դուք պետք է մի Ping երթուղղիչ ստուգել, ​​որ ձեր համակարգիչը կարող է միանալ դրան, այն վերացնել այն որպես հնարավոր պատճառ ցանցային հարցի.

Ping հրամանների առկայություն

Ping հրահանգը հասանելի է Windows 10 , Windows 8 , Windows 7 , Windows Vista եւ Windows XP օպերացիոն համակարգերի հրամանի պատվերով: Ping հրահանգը հասանելի է նաեւ Windows- ի 98-ի եւ 95-ի նախկին տարբերակներում:

The ping հրամանը կարող է հայտնաբերվել հրամանատարության արագության մեջ Ընդլայնված գործարկման ընտրանքներ եւ համակարգի վերականգնման ընտրանքներ վերանորոգման / վերականգնման բաժիններում:

Նշում. Որոշակի ping հրամանատարների եւ այլ ping հրամանների շարադրանքի առկայությունը կարող է տարբերվել օպերացիոն համակարգի օպերացիոն համակարգից:

Ping հրամանների շարահյուսություն

ping [ -t ] [ -a ] [ -s count ] [ -l size ] [ -f ] [ -i TTL ] [ -v TOS ] [ -r count ] [ -s count ] [ -w timeout ] [ - R ] [ -s srcaddr ] [ -p ] [ -4 ] [ -6 ] թիրախ [ /? []

Խորհուրդ. Տեսեք, թե ինչպես կարդալ Հրահանգային տեքստի սխեմա, եթե համոզված չեք, թե ինչպես պետք է մեկնաբանել ping- ի հրամանատարության սինտիշը, ինչպես նկարագրված է վերեւում կամ ստորեւ բերված աղյուսակում:

Օգտագործելով այս տարբերակը, կպահանջի թիրախը, քանի դեռ ստիպված չեք լինի դադարեցնել Ctrl-C- ը :
Այս ping հրամանների տարբերակը կլուծի, եթե հնարավոր է, IP հասցեի թիրախի հոստնու անունը :
հաշվելը Այս տարբերակը սահմանում է ICMP Echo Requests- ի համարը, 1-ից 4294967295-ը: Պինգի հրամանները 4-ը կուղարկեն լռակյաց, եթե -n օգտագործված չէ:
չափը Օգտագործեք այս տարբերակը `echo հարցում փաթեթի չափը, բայթերում` 32-ից մինչեւ 65,527: The ping հրամանը կուղարկի 32 բայթային echo հարցում, եթե դուք չեք օգտագործում -l տարբերակը:
Օգտագործեք այս ping հրամանի տարբերակը կանխելու համար ICMP Echo Requests- ը բաժանված լինելու ձեր եւ թիրախի միջեւ երթուղղիչներով: The -f տարբերակը առավել հաճախ օգտագործվում է ճանապարհի առավելագույն փոխանցման միավորի (PMTU) խնդիրների լուծման համար:
-i TTL Այս տարբերակը սահմանում է Time to Live (TTL) արժեքը, որի առավելագույն քանակը 255 է:
-v TOS- ը Այս տարբերակը թույլ է տալիս Ձեզ սահմանել Ծառայության տեսակը (TOS) արժեք: Սկսած Windows 7-ում, այս տարբերակը այլեւս չի գործում, սակայն առկա է համատեղելիության պատճառով:
- հաշվելը Օգտագործեք այս ping հրամանության տարբերակը `ձեր համակարգչի եւ թիրախային համակարգչի կամ սարքի միջեւ փաթաթումների թիվը որոշելու համար, որը ցանկանում եք գրանցվել եւ ցուցադրվել: Հաշվի համար առավելագույն արժեքը 9 է, այնպես որ օգտագործեք tracert հրամանը, եթե փոխարենը շահագրգռեք բոլոր սարքերի միջեւ երկու սարքերի միջեւ:
- հաշվում է Օգտագործեք այս տարբերակը ժամանակի մասին, Ինտերնետային ժամանակահատվածի ձեւաչափով, որ յուրաքանչյուր արձագանքման արձանագրություն ստացվի եւ արձագանքեք պատասխանը: Հաշվարկի առավելագույն արժեքը 4 է, ինչը նշանակում է, որ միայն առաջին չորս քամոցները կարող են ժամանակի կնքվել:
- ժամանակն է Պինգի հրամանատարության կատարման ժամանակահատվածի արժեքը սահմանելով ժամանակի չափը կարգավորում է միլիոնավոր վայրկյանում, այդ պինգը սպասում է յուրաքանչյուր պատասխանին: Եթե ​​դուք չօգտագործեք -w տարբերակը, օգտագործվում է 4000-ի կանխադրված ժամկետային արժեքը, որը 4 վայրկյան է:
Այս տարբերակը պատմում է ping- ի հրամանին `կլոր ուղու ուղիների հետքը դիտելու համար:
-S srcaddr Օգտագործեք այս տարբերակը աղբյուրի հասցեն նշելու համար:
Օգտագործեք այս անջատիչը ` Hyper-V ցանցի վիրտուալացման մատակարարի հասցեն փակցնելու համար :
-4 Սա ստիպում է ping- ի հրամանին օգտագործել միայն IPv4- ը, բայց միայն անհրաժեշտ է, եթե թիրախը հանդիսանում է սերվերի անուն, այլ ոչ թե IP հասցե:
-6 Սա ստիպում է ping- ի հրամանին օգտագործել միայն IPv6- ը, սակայն, ինչպես -4-ի տարբերակով, անհրաժեշտ է միայն այն ժամանակ, երբ hostname- ը սեղմում է:
թիրախը Սա այն վայրն է, որը ցանկանում եք ping, կամ IP հասցեն կամ hostname:
/? Օգտագործեք օգնության փոխարկիչը ping հրամանով `հրամանների մի քանի տարբերակների մասին մանրամասն ցուցադրելու համար:

Նշում. -f , -v , -r , -s , -j , եւ -k տարբերակները աշխատում են միայն IPv4 հասցեների սեղմման ժամանակ: The -R եւ -S տարբերակները գործում են միայն IPv6- ի հետ:

Ping- ի հրամանատարության այլ պակաս հաճախ օգտագործվող անջատիչներ գոյություն ունեն, ներառյալ [ -j host-list ], [ -k host-list ] եւ [ -c compartment ]: Կատարել ping /? Հրամանատարության խնդրանքով այս ընտրանքների վերաբերյալ լրացուցիչ տեղեկությունների համար:

Խորհուրդ. Դուք կարող եք պահպանել ping հրամանի արտադրանքը ֆայլի վրա `օգտագործելով վերահղման օպերատոր : Տեսեք, թե ինչպես վերուղղել Command Output- ի ֆայլի հրահանգներ կամ տեսնել մեր Հրամանի Խնդրի Հնարքներ ցուցակը, ավելի շատ խորհուրդներ ստանալու համար:

Ping հրամանատարության օրինակներ

ping -n 5 -l 1500 www.google.com

Այս օրինակում, ping հրամանն օգտագործվում է www.google.com hostname- ին: The -n տարբերակը պատմում է ping- ի հրամանին, 4 լռակյաց փոխարեն ուղարկելու ICMP Echo Requests- ը, եւ -l տարբերակը սահմանում է յուրաքանչյուր հարցման փաթեթի չափը 1500 բայթ, 32 բայթու փոխարեն:

Հրամանատարության ակնարկ պատուհանում ցուցադրվող արդյունքը նման է նման բանին.

Pinging www.google.com [74.125.224.82] 1500 բայթ տվյալների հետ `Պատասխանել 74.125.224.82: բայթ = 1500 ժամանակ = 68մմ TTL = 52 Պատասխան 74.125.224.82: bytes = 1500 ժամանակ = 68մմ TTL = 52 Պատասխանել 74.125 : 224.82: bytes = 1500 time = 65ms TTL = 52 Պատասխանել 74.125.224.82: bytes = 1500 ժամանակ = 66 մմ TTL = 52 Պատասխանել 74.125.224.82: bytes = 1500 ժամանակ = 70 մմ TTL = 52 Ping վիճակագրությունը 74.125.224.82: : Ուղարկված = 5, ստացված = 5, կորած = 0 (0% կորուստ), մոտավոր շրջադարձային ժամեր ազգային-վայրկյանում. Նվազագույնը = 65 մս, առավելագույնը = 70մմ, միջին = 67 մմ

74.125.224.82 համար Ping- ի վիճակագրության 0% կորուստը պատմում է ինձ, որ www.google.com- ին ուղարկված յուրաքանչյուր ICMP Echo Request- ի հաղորդագրությունը վերադարձվել է: Սա նշանակում է, որ իմ ցանցային կապի շնորհիվ կարող եմ շփվել Google- ի կայքի հետ:

ping 127.0.0.1

Վերոնշյալ օրինակում ես գրում եմ 127.0.0.1-ը , որը նաեւ կոչվում է IPv4 localhost IP հասցեն կամ IPv4- ի loopback IP- հասցե , առանց ընտրանքների:

Օգտագործելով ping- ի հրամանատարությունը ping 127.0.0.1-ի համար , գերադասելի է ստուգել, ​​որ Windows- ի ցանցի առանձնահատկությունները պատշաճ կերպով աշխատում են, բայց դա ոչինչ չի ասում ձեր սեփական ցանցային ապարատի կամ որեւէ այլ համակարգչի կամ սարքին կապի մասին:

Այս թեստի IPv6 տարբերակը կլինի ping :: 1 :

ping-a 192.168.1.22

Այս օրինակում ես խնդրում եմ ping- ի հրամանին գտնել 192.168.1.22 IP հասցեին վերապահված hostname- ն, այլապես այն նորմալացնելով:

Pinging J3RTY22 [192.168.1.22] տվյալների 32 բայթով: Պատասխան 192.168.1.22: bytes = 32 անգամ

Ինչպես տեսնում եք, ping հրամանը լուծեց IP հասցեն, որը ես մուտքագրել եմ 192.168.1.22 , որպես hostname J3RTY22 , եւ հետո կատարեց պինգի մնացորդը լռելյայն կարգավորումներով:

ping -t -6 սերվեր

Այս օրինակում ես ստիպում եմ ping- ի հրամանին օգտագործել IPv6-ը -6 տարբերակը եւ շարունակել ping SERVER անորոշ ժամանակով -t տարբերակով:

Pinging SERVER [fe80 :: fd1a: 3327: 2937: 7df3 10%] 32 բայթ տվյալների հետ: Պատասխանել fe80 :: fd1a: 3327: 2937: 7df3% 10: time = 1ms Պատասխանել fe80 :: fd1a: 3327: 2937 : 7df3% 10: ժամանակը

Ես ընդհատում եմ Ping- ի ձեռքով Ctrl-C- ով յոթ պատասխաններից հետո: Բացի այդ, ինչպես տեսնում եք, -6 տարբերակը ստեղծեց IPv6 հասցեները:

Հուշում: Այս ping հրահանգի օրինակով ստացված պատասխաններից% -ը համարվում է IPv6 գոտի ID- ն, որն առավել հաճախ ցույց է տալիս ցանցային ինտերֆեյսը: Դուք կարող եք ստեղծել գոտի ID- ների աղյուսակը, որը համապատասխանում է ձեր ցանցային ինտերֆեյսի անուններին `կատարելով netsh ինտերֆեյսի ipv6 շոու ինտերֆեյս : IPv6 գոտու ID- ն Idx սյունակում թվ է :

Ping- ի հետ կապված հրամաններ

Ping- ի հրամանը հաճախ օգտագործվում է ցանցի հետ կապված Հրամանների արագ արձագանքման հրամաններով, ինչպիսիք են tracert , ipconfig, netstat , nslookup եւ այլն: